WebSubtrochanteric Fractures. Subtrochanteric fractures are proximal femur fractures located within 5 cm of the lesser trochanter that may occur in low energy (elderly) or high energy (young patients) mechanisms. Diagnosis is made with orthogonal radiographs of the hip in patients that present with inability to bear weight.
